Ejercicio en C: Uso de scanf() y printf()

Descripción del problema: Crear un programa en lenguaje C que pida el nombre y luego la edad, después el programa deberá imprimir el nombre ingresado previamente tantas veces como se indica en la edad. Es decir, si la edad es 10, el nombre de la persona se imprimirá 10 veces.

La solución se muestra a continuación:


    #include <stdio.h>

    int main()
    {
        char nombre[100];
        int edad;

        printf("Escribe tu nombre:");
        scanf("%[^\n]", &nombre);
        printf("Escribe tu Edad:");
        scanf("%i", &edad);

        for(int i = 0; i < edad; i++)
        {
            printf("%i. %s \n", (i+1), nombre);
        }
        return 0;
    }


Comentarios